https://docs.inductiveautomation.com/docs/8.1/platform/gateway/status/connections/connections-databasesThe Databases page shows a list of configured databases, and if they have a valid connection or not. Clicking on the Details button to the right of a connection will either show the full error if the connection is faulted, or it will bring you to a Details page for that database connection. https://docs.inductiveautomation.com/docs/8.1/platform/gateway/config/web-server-settingsThe Web Server page is for configuring the HTTP and HTTPS ports, enabling SSL/TLS, redirecting traffic through a known address, and specifying whether or not all HTTP traffic should be forcefully redirecting to HTTPS.
